Biography

Mohamed Abd Elaziz received the B.S. and M.S. degrees in computer science and the Ph.D. degree in mathematics and computer science from Zagazig University, Egypt, in 2008, 2011, and 2014, respectively. From 2008 to 2011, he was an Assistant Lecturer with the Department of Computer Science. He is an Associate Professor with Zagazig University. He is the author of more than 430 articles. He is one of the 2% influential scholars, which depicts the 100,000 top-scientists in the world. He is one of the highest cited researchers according to WOS 2022. His research interests include metaheuristic technique, medical application, digital twins, renewable energy, security IoT, cloud computing, machine learning, signal processing, image processing, and evolutionary algorithms.
